The Missouri Department of Corrections focuses on fostering public safety and health through a comprehensive approach that includes treatment, education, and job training for justice-involved individuals. With a commitment to rehabilitation, the department aims to equip those returning to their communities with the necessary skills to become productive and responsible neighbors.
In addition to its rehabilitative services, the department emphasizes restorative justice initiatives and community involvement, such as the Puppies for Parole program, which facilitates the training of service dogs by inmates. Through these efforts, the Missouri Department of Corrections strives to improve lives and contribute to safer communities throughout the state.
